A NEW visual arts language and story are to be writ large on city sites as of Friday 12 with the launch of LANDLOCKED. This is a suite of 10 documentary video portraits projected on to Limerick walls, shot by filmmaker Christina Gangos who used to live here.

โ€œParticipants were asked to contemplate life-changing events for ten minutes while they were filmed,โ€ says PRO Rรณisรญn Buckley. โ€œTheir thoughts are kept private, yet the camera documents the physical process, the slight movements and gentle motions of a body in thoughtโ€.

Those who took who took part in the 20metre x 11.25m images ranged in age from eight to 50. The map of projections can be read on website www.landlocked-ireland.com.
